Why it is worth attention

It packages a real research workflow—spanning biological questions, lab observations, computation, and mechanical phenotype interpretation—into a public, static website that is easy to host and browse.

Considerations

  • Content updates require editing HTML source files and regenerating assets rather than using runtime configuration
  • Scope is limited to this specific research project; no general-purpose analysis tools are documented
  • The README does not link raw datasets or a code repository, making deeper verification harder
